Overview

Discover the historic and very charming town of Colchester while you stay at this delightful duplex located less than a mile from the shore of Mallets Bay. Venture out and explore the area where you'll find a number of villages, parks, breweries, and other local attractions including the famed Salmon Hole on the Winooski River, the Champlain Valley Exposition for phenomenal live music and other events, the Ethan Allen Homestead Museum and Historic Site, and Church Street Marketplace (home of the Burlington Discover Jazz Festival), all within 10 miles of this property. This home is also convenient to several colleges including UVM and SMC (six miles), Champlain (seven miles), and Middlebury (40 miles south).

Inside this two-story, 19th-century vacation rental, you'll find a well-equipped, open-concept kitchen with a breakfast bar, a large dining table for mealtimes or family board game nights, and a comfortably furnished living area with a sofa bed and smart TV.

Outdoors, take advantage of the grassy yard for summertime fun.

THINGS TO KNOW

This vacation rental is not equipped with air-conditioning.

You must be 21 years or older to rent this property.

Stewart H2024-10-28

Kitchen/dining area and bathroom has been modernised, but the rest is a little dated, but perfectly adequate. Sloping ceilings on second floor restrict the ability to add a toilet and having to go downstairs in the middle of the night is a bit of a pain. The stairs are very narrow, so wouldn’t suit anyone elderly or with reduced mobility. Otherwise a very nice property.
